Control Center problem

Hi everybody!
I have DB2 v7.2 installed on Win2K, and i try to access it, using DB2 Control Center v8.1. I had cataloged database using DB2 Configuration Assistant and test connection was fine. But when I try to click on the node usingn DB2 Control Center v8.1 i got this:

SQL1651N The request cannot be executed
because the DB2 server version
does not support this
functionality.

Explanation: Some new functionality is not
supported against older DB2 server versions.
Another possible cause of this error could be the
request referenced objects with qualifiers of
length that exceeds the support of the server
version.

User Response: Execute the request against a
DB2 server where the latest DB2 server version
has been installed, or upgrade the server to the
latest DB2 server version.

Is it so, i think that I can access v7.2 using DB2 CC v8.1.
Any ideas?

cc

most of the time : servers should be migrated first and later the clients
if a client uses new function/protocol.. this is not understood by lower server
